diff --git a/src/calibre/gui2/__init__.py b/src/calibre/gui2/__init__.py index ba8a369d1f..564edeaddd 100644 --- a/src/calibre/gui2/__init__.py +++ b/src/calibre/gui2/__init__.py @@ -1471,12 +1471,13 @@ empty_index = empty_model.index(0) def set_app_uid(val): import ctypes from ctypes import wintypes + from ctypes import HRESULT try: AppUserModelID = ctypes.windll.shell32.SetCurrentProcessExplicitAppUserModelID except Exception: # Vista has no app uids return False AppUserModelID.argtypes = [wintypes.LPCWSTR] - AppUserModelID.restype = wintypes.HRESULT + AppUserModelID.restype = HRESULT try: AppUserModelID(unicode_type(val)) except Exception as err: